Abstract

ISO/IEC 19778 is applicable to collaborative technologies used to support communication among learners, instructors and other participants. The implementation and communicative use of these technologies entails the creation of information related to participant groups, and to the collaborative environments, functions and tools that are set up for, and used by, these groups. ISO/IEC 19778-1:2008 - together with its subsequent parts - defines data models that enable the portability and reuse of this data in integrated form, and allow Data Model instantiations to be interchanged, stored, retrieved, reused or analysed by a variety of systems. ISO/IEC 19778-1:2008 specifies a table-based approach for defining Data Models. This Data Model specification is used for specifying the collaborative workplace Data Model. The same Data Model specification is also used in ISO/IEC 19778-2 and ISO/IEC 19778-3 to define the related components of the collaborative environment (ISO/IEC 19778-2) and the collaborative group (ISO/IEC 19778-3) in separate Data Models.
